Jason Wong was born and raised in London, United Kingdom. Growing up in a multicultural environment, he was influenced by both his British upbringing and his Chinese heritage. From a young age, Wong showed a keen interest in the performing arts and physical fitness. He eventually pursued professional training at the prestigious Royal Central School of Speech and Drama in London, a school known for producing some of the worlds finest actors. This classical background provided him with a solid foundation in theater and character work, which he would later translate into a successful screen career. His early years were marked by a dedication to honing his craft, often taking on small roles in independent productions and theater to build his resume.

His first significant steps into the entertainment industry involved guest appearances on popular British television series. He appeared in shows like Missing and the long running crime drama Silent Witness. These early roles allowed him to gain experience on professional sets and catch the eye of casting directors. However, his breakthrough moment came when he was cast in the series Strangers also known as White Dragon, where he played the character Kai. This role showcased his ability to handle complex, emotionally driven narratives alongside high stakes action. This visibility led to his casting in Guy Ritchies 2019 film The Gentlemen, where he played the memorable role of Phuc. The films success in the United States and globally significantly boosted his international profile, making him a recognizable face to American audiences.

Throughout his career, Wong has achieved several milestones, including roles in major franchise films. Notable works include his performance in Chimerica, the action thriller Jarhead Law of Return, and the massive fantasy hit Dungeons and Dragons Honor Among Thieves, where he played the formidable Dralas. His filmography is characterized by a mix of gritty crime dramas and large scale action adventures. In recent years, he also joined the cast of Guy Ritchies The Covenant, further solidifying his professional relationship with the acclaimed director. Wong has been praised for his commitment to his roles, often performing his own stunts due to his extensive background in martial arts, including Wing Chun and Brazilian Jiu Jitsu.
